/* Hauptmenü */
#main_left { 
position: relative;
top:0px; 
left:5px; 
float: left;
width:190px; 
height:774px; 
background-color: #FFFFFF; 
z-index:9; 
/*background-image:url(../images/menu/back1.jpg);*/
background-repeat:no-repeat;
/*background-attachment:fixed;*/
}

#menue18 {
position:relative;
top:5px;
list-style-type: none;
}
#menue18 ul {
list-style: none;
list-style-type: none;
margin: 0;
padding: 5px;
font-size: 11pt;
}
#menue18 li.level1 {
width: 100px;
height: 680px;
padding: 60px 15px 20px 5px;
font-variant: normal;
font-weight:bold;
font-size:110%;
border: 0.1px solid;
border-color: #B0C4DE #000 #000 #B0C4DE;
list-style: none;
list-style-type: none;
}
#menue18 li.level2 {
font-variant: normal;
width: 120px;
margin-top: 7px;
margin-left: 15px;
padding: 3px 10px;
border-left: 8px solid #B0C4DE;
/*border-color: #3385ff #000 #000 #3385ff;*/
list-style: none;
background-color: /*#048adb*/  #3366FF;
color: #fff;
}
#menue18 li.level2 a.hide_me { display: none; }
#menue18 li.level2:last-child { display: none; }
#menue18 li.level3 {
width: 150px;
margin-top: 2px;
margin-left: 30px;
padding: 2px 5px;
border-left: 5px solid;
border-color: #39f #000 #000 #39f;
background-color: #99CCFF;
color: #fc0;
list-style-type: none;
font-size: 11pt;
font-weight:normal;
}
#menue18 li.level1 a, 
#menue18 li.level2 a, 
#menue18 li.level3 a {
display: block;
padding-left: 5px;
text-decoration: none;
}
#menue18 li.level1 a:link,
#menue18 li.level1 a:visited,
#menue18 li.level1 a:active {
background-color: transparent;
color: #e1cba2;
}
#menue18 li.level1 a:hover {
background-color: transparent;
color: #eee2cc;
width: auto;
}
#menue18 li.level2 a:link, 
#menue18 li.level3 a:link,
#menue18 li.level2 a:visited, 
#menue18 li.level3 a:visited,
#menue18 li.level2 a:active, 
#menue18 li.level3 a:active {
background-color: transparent;
color: #fff;
border: 1px solid;
}
#menue18 li.level2 a:link,
#menue18 li.level2 a:visited,
#menue18 li.level2 a:active {
border-color:  #3366FF/*#048adb*/;
}
#menue18 li.level3 a:link,
#menue18 li.level3 a:visited, 
#menue18 li.level3 a:active {
border-color: #048adb;
}
#menue18 li.level2 a:hover, 
#menue18 li.level3 a:hover {
padding-left: 6px;
background-color: transparent;
color: #ffffff /*#3366FF*/;
border: 1px solid;
}
#menue18 li.level2 a:hover {
border-color: #0472b3 #24aafb #24aafb #0472b3;
}
#menue18 li.level3 a:hover {
border-color: #0472b3 #24aafb #24aafb #0472b3;
} 
  